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Edmond Memorial Football Foundation show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Edmond Memorial Football Foundation's revenue has grown by 136.1%, moving from $75K to $178K. Total assets increased by 528.3% over the same period, from $33K to $206K. Total functional expenses rose by 52.3%, from $61K to $92K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Edmond Memorial Football Foundation reported a surplus of $85K, with revenue exceeding expenses.

YearRevenueExpensesAssetsLiabilitiesOfficer Comp. %PDF
2023 $178K $92K $206K $0 View 990
2022 $168K $125K $121K $0 View 990
2021 $134K $114K $78K $0
2020 $59K $48K $58K $0
2019 $76K $82K $46K $0 View 990
2018 $65K $66K $53K $0 View 990
2017 $61K $64K $54K $0 View 990
2016 $90K $63K $56K $0 View 990
2015 $69K $76K $30K $0 View 990
2014 $114K $119K $36K $0 View 990
2013 $107K $103K $42K $0 View 990
2012 $78K $73K $38K $0 View 990
2011 $75K $61K $33K $0 View 990

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
